In this electrifying clash between Dewa United FC and PSS Sleman on the 6th of October in Liga 1, the statistics and raw data display a remarkable game filled with talent. Dewa United FC netted three goals to secure victory on their home turf, while PSS Sleman managed to score only once.

It's worth noting that Dewa United FC wasted no time and showed a strong start, scoring their first goal within the first 12 minutes of the match. This established momentum and gave the team a psychological edge. Their second goal came at the 39 minutes mark, showing their firm control and consistency in the first half of the game.

PSS Sleman, however, demonstrated resilience and made a determined comeback in the second half, scoring a goal after 87 minutes. Nevertheless, their rejoicing was short-lived as Dewa United FC responded with a devastating strike within 2 minutes, swiftly reclaiming their two-goal lead.

Meanwhile, the corner kicks data suggests a significant edge for Dewa United FC, with 5 kicks compared to 2 for Sleman. Corner kicks often signify offensive pressure and dominance, which seems to be the case here. This could have contributed to Dewa United's superior goal count.

Yellow card data for both teams shows a marginally higher tendency for fouls by the home team. Dewa United FC received two yellow cards in the first half, which could indicate their aggressive approach to maintaining their lead. On the contrary, the away team got only one yellow card, suggesting a cleaner defensive strategy.

Furthermore, offsides data reveals that both teams had somewhat comparable strategic weaknesses. The away team strayed offside thrice, while the home team was flagged for offsides twice. This implies both teams' eagerness to press forward and their potential vulnerability to well-coordinated defensive traps.

Finally, with no red cards given to either team, we can conclude that despite some instances of aggressive play, this match was marked with fair play and sportsmanship.

In summary, based on the provided statistics, it can be inferred that Dewa United FC's aggressive offensive game, marked by early goals and more corner kicks, combined with a timely response to PSS Sleman's goal in the second half, led to their victory. On the other hand, PSS Sleman's performance shows that despite their resilience and comparatively cleaner defense, their inability to convert opportunities and maintain offensive pressure cost them the game.
